What Is this Adjustable Oil Filter Wrench Like to Use?
The claw head automatically adjusts to the right size for your oil filter. Connect your 1/2-inch wrench to the head of the tool, and place it on the top of the filter.
Use the tool-less adjustment to turn the wrench until the claws engage the filter, and then twist it off in seconds. The wrench provides secure fitment over the filter, without any tool slippage during use, even if you have oil on the filter surface.
